Disasta's Cleaner Strain Overview
Disasta's Cleaner is a relatively rare hybrid cannabis strain that emerged from the West Coast cannabis scene in the early 2010s. The strain's exact origins are somewhat obscure, with limited documentation available from breeders. It appears to have been developed through selective breeding practices aimed at creating a balanced hybrid with distinctive cleaning-related terpene profiles. The name suggests a connection to cleaning or purifying effects, though this is largely anecdotal rather than scientifically verified.
The strain typically produces medium-sized, dense buds with a frosty trichome coverage that gives them a sparkling appearance. The coloration ranges from deep forest green to occasional purple hues, particularly in cooler growing conditions. Orange pistils weave through the buds, creating visual contrast. The buds are known for their resinous texture and sticky feel when properly cured. The strain's rarity means that consistent phenotypic expression can vary between different growers and batches.
Notable features include its complex aromatic profile that combines elements of fuel, citrus, and pine with underlying earthy notes. The strain has gained a small but dedicated following among connoisseurs who appreciate its balanced effects and unique flavor combination. Due to its limited commercial availability, Disasta's Cleaner is more commonly found in private grows and specialty dispensaries rather than mainstream markets.

Disasta's Cleaner Strain Growing Information
Disasta's Cleaner is considered a moderate-difficulty strain to cultivate, requiring some experience for optimal results. The flowering time typically ranges from 8 to 10 weeks when grown indoors. Outdoor plants are usually ready for harvest in late September to early October in northern hemisphere climates. The strain prefers a controlled indoor environment but can adapt to outdoor growing in Mediterranean-like climates with consistent temperatures.
Indoor yields average 400-500 grams per square meter, while outdoor plants can produce 500-600 grams per plant under ideal conditions. The plants tend to be medium in height, reaching 120-160 cm indoors and potentially taller outdoors. They respond well to training techniques like topping and low-stress training to maximize light exposure and bud development. The strain requires good air circulation to prevent mold due to its dense bud structure. Nutrient needs are moderate, with sensitivity to overfeeding during the flowering phase.
